How Does AI Object Removal Work?
Artificial intelligence-driven tools utilize cutting-edge techniques to analyze the layout of an photo. By understanding the scene, the system can precisely replace the removed areas with corresponding details.
Several tools use neural networks to estimate the most suitable fill for the removed element. This guarantees that the adjusted picture looks realistic and undetectable.

Step-by-Step Guide to Removing Objects with AI
When using a software or web-based tool, the steps typically requires the following actions:
1. Load Your Image: Launch the platform and import the image you'd like to enhance.
2. Pick the Element to Remove: Utilize the marking feature to mark the unwanted item.
3. Apply the AI Deletion: Select the appropriate option to allow the algorithm handle the request.
4. Examine and Download: Once the software processes the deletion, examine the result and export the final file.
Common Challenges and Solutions
Despite the powerful functions of AI, some challenges may arise when removing objects:
- Detailed Backgrounds: If the background has intricate textures, the AI may struggle replacing the deleted part. Fix: Hands-on adjust the result using extra editing options.
- Partial Object Removal: Sometimes, the AI may fail to remove remnants of the element. Workaround: Zoom in the image and retry the deletion function.
